Informatik Seminar 2003 - Parsen
Informatik Seminar 2003 - Parsen
Informatik Seminar 2003 - Parsen
Erfolgreiche ePaper selbst erstellen
Machen Sie aus Ihren PDF Publikationen ein blätterbares Flipbook mit unserer einzigartigen Google optimierten e-Paper Software.
Grundlagen<br />
Funktionale Parser in Haskell<br />
Ein Parser für arithmetische Ausdrücke<br />
<strong>Parsen</strong> mit Parsec<br />
Berechnung ausführen<br />
Berechne die Anzahl der Klammernpaare<br />
> noOfBrace = do{ char ’{’<br />
> ; m ; char ’}’<br />
> ; n ; return (1+m+n);<br />
> }<br />
> return 0<br />
? parseTest noOfBrace "{}{}"<br />
2<br />
? parseTest noOfBrace "{{}}{}"<br />
3<br />
Was ist Parsec?<br />
Beispiel mit Parsec<br />
Ein Taschenrechner<br />
Jens Kulenkamp <strong>Informatik</strong> <strong>Seminar</strong> <strong>2003</strong> - <strong>Parsen</strong>